Hartman named MVC Player of the Week for third time this season
11/3/2025 3:00:00 PM | Women's Volleyball
ST. LOUIS --- UNI junior outside hitter Cassidy Hartman has been named the Missouri Valley Conference's (MVC) Player of the Week for volleyball, as announced by the league office on Monday afternoon.
The selection comes for the North Liberty, Iowa native after led the Panthers with a pair of double-digit kill showings and one double-double performances in victories over Belmont and Southern Illinois, helping UNI improve to 12-0 in league play.Â
Northern Iowa is currently in the midst of a 15-match winning streak, tied for the second-longest in Division I, while also having won 48 consecutive regular season matches against MVC opponents, the third-longest such streak in program history and the second-longest active streak in the nation. UNI is also closing in on at least a share of its fourth straight MVC regular season title this week.
UNI's season leader with 352 total blocks on the year, Hartman notably set a new career-high with 26 terminations in the Panthers' 3-1 win at Southern Illinois on Saturday, while also tallying 11 digs for her team-leading 11th double-double of the season. Hartman also recorded 11 kills against Belmont last Thursday, having now posted ten or more kills in 19 matches this year.
Hartman's selection is the eighth MVC weekly award of the season for the Panthers, who have also seen Maryn Bixby be named the MVC Freshman of the Week three times, and Jadyn Petersen the league's top defense player of the week twice.Â
In addition to Hartman, Valparaiso's Emma Hickey was named MVC Defensive Player of the Week for a second straight week, while Drake's Caroline Smith earned MVC Freshman of the Week honors.
